Your Impact The Materials Handler will perform an array of functions including but not limited to: Receiving and processing incoming products, picking and filling customer orders, managing and organizing product stock, and loading/offloading of trucks. Your work is essential to maintaining inventory accuracy, safety, and operational flow as we scale. Your Day-to-Day Responsibilities Assist in the administration of shipping and receiving of truck loads, checking in products, and matching purchase orders. File requests for materials, tools, or other stock items. Perform daily cycle counts. Clear and manage the materials queue in Epicor. Ensure the warehouse is accessible and safe for employees and customers. Pull parts for production and customer orders using ERP Sales Order Pick List. Package orders to prevent shipping damage. Load and unload trucks with materials and supplies. Load and package items onto pallets, label, wrap, and strap for shipping. Inventory, organize and label items within the warehouse. Clean work area and remove trash daily. Qualifications Minimum one year of experience in a warehouse associate/shipping position, preferably in a manufacturing facility. Minimum 1 year experience driving a forklift is required. Good verbal and written communication skills. Good data entry, math and computer skills. Effective communication skills. Good organizational skills. Attention to detail. Ability to follow-through on assignments. Excellent time management skills. Ability to work independently and unsupervised while prioritizing tasks. Self-motivated, with the ability to lead projects to completion with minimal oversight.
